TWIN METALS MINNESOTA STATEMENT REGARDING ENACTMENT OF MINERAL WITHDRAWAL IN NORTHEAST MINNESOTA

Ely, Minn., Jan. 26, 2023 – Twin Metals Minnesota is deeply disappointed and stunned that the federal government has chosen to enact a 20-year moratorium on mining across a quarter million acres of land in northeast Minnesota. This region sits on top of one of the world’s largest deposits of critical minerals that are vital in meeting our nation’s goals to transition to a clean energy future, to create American jobs, to strengthen our national security and to bolster domestic supply chains. TWIN METALS MINNESOTA BRINGS FEDERAL LAWSUIT TO COUNTER REGULATORY MISCONDUCT

Ely, Minn., Aug. 22, 2022 – Twin Metals Minnesota filed a significant lawsuit in the United States District Court in Washington, D.C., today to reclaim its federal mineral leases and reverse a series of arbitrary and capricious actions by federal agencies aimed at preventing the development of its modern mining project in northern Minnesota. These actions by the Department of Interior and Bureau of Land Management undercut America’s long-term priorities of securing domestic supply chains, addressing climate change by moving toward a clean energy future, and strengthening national security….
